R.T.G. Arts and Science College B.Sc. Eligibility and Highlights 2025
B.Sc. at R.T.G. Arts and Science College is a full time course offered at the UG level. It is of 3 years duration. The students who are Class 12 or equivalent exam pass from a recognised board are eligible for admission. After selection, the candidates must pay the admission fee amount to confirm their seat. R.T.G. Arts and Science College B.Sc.R.T.G. Arts and Science College B.Sc. Seats 2025
R.T.G. Arts and Science College B.Sc. offers 210 seats. The applicants are admitted as per the sanctioned intake only. Candidates can have a look at the table below to get an idea of the R.T.G. Arts and Science College B.Sc. seat intake:
| Courses | Seats |
|---|---|
| B.Sc. in Computer Science | 90 |
| B.Sc. in Mathematics | 70 |
| B.Sc. in Chemistry | 50 |
